About the role
This is an unarmed law enforcement position (Title 33 Commission). Limited Commission Park Ranger positions involve extensive customer service and public contact while enforcing Colorado Parks and Wildlife laws and regulations.
Responsibilities
- Enforce park laws and regulations; issue citations for violations; patrol park areas by motor vehicle, Off-Highway Vehicle (OHV) and/or foot.
- Respond to emergencies and resolve visitor complaints.
- Complete reports and may be required to appear in court.
- Aid visitor services operations including providing quality customer service, revenue collection and verification, accounting and deposits, and education and interpretive programs.
- Aid with all general park maintenance and cleaning of public facilities including: restrooms, vault toilets, campsites, picnic areas, trails, etc.
- Operate and perform routine maintenance on State owned vehicles, equipment, and facilities.
- Assist with carpentry, plumbing, masonry, electrical work and transporting materials and supplies.
- Assist with all areas of daily park operations and other duties as assigned.
